This Valentine's Day, we are partnering with Global Outreach to kickoff a fundraising campaign in order to bring a water pipeline to the Congo for Christ Orphanage in Uvira, Congo. Immediate Beneficiaries
-63 orphans are waiting for water so they can move into their dormitory
-10 widows serve as caregivers for the orphans
-21 Bible college students are currently in training on the campus
-3 teachers and their families permanently reside on the campus
-the church also regularly feeds its 200-300 member congregation
Cost
$35,647.30 will purchase the equipment and labor to install:
-an intake system from the Mugaja River
-2000 meters of buried pipeline
-a filtration system
-a reservoir
-3 distribution points at the Congo for Christ compound
Over $20,000 has already been contributed by Global Outreach partners.

On Sunday, April 3rd the A1:8 Congo Missions Team from National Community Church will partner with Invisible Children to bring the "Congo Tour" to Ebenezers Coffeehouse. We will be showing the new documentary film "Tony" and will also hear stories from their Ugandan teammate.
The Congo Missions Team will also be raising funds for their mission trip in June, specifically a water pipeline project for Congo for Christ Orphanage. The team will be debuting a limited edition Congo t-shirt available in men's and women's sizes. Proceeds from sales will benefit the water pipeline project.
